Never tried this stuff due to the possibility of gyno. Back in the day, though, I ran something called Propadrol that is apparently close to LMG and had no issues. Thinking of running LMG with Mechadrol. Anyone with some insight on LMG?

burlyman30
12-07-2013, 01:27 AM
It's very similar to deca, but in an oral form. It is easier on the liver, as it is a 13-ethinyl vs a 17-alpha alkalate. It's not harsh on the system in comparison to many other compounds, but is an effective "wet" compound. The gains are gradual and consistent in contrast to a superdrol type compound with gains fast and furious. I've used it in conjunction with a dry compound, I think PPs turinabol, and it was a nice addition.
